Spicy Shrimp and Vegetable Stir-Fry Recipe

  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Description

This vibrant and flavorful Spicy Shrimp and Vegetable Stir-Fry combines succulent shrimp with crisp bell peppers, broccoli, and carrots in a zesty, spicy sauce. Perfect for a quick and healthy dinner, this Asian-inspired dish is packed with protein and colorful vegetables, making it both nutritious and delicious.


Ingredients

Shrimp and Vegetables

  • 1 pound large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 yellow b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 cup broccoli florets
  • 1 medium carrot, thinly s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on ginger, minced

Sauce

  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sriracha or other hot sauce
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on honey
  • 1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ional)

For Cooking and Garnish

  • 2 tablespoons vegetable or sesame oil
  • 2 green onions, sliced for garnish
  • 1 teaspoon sesame seeds (optional)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, sriracha, rice vinegar, honey, and crushed red pepper flakes if using. Set this spicy sauce mixture aside.
  2. Cook the Shrimp: Heat 1 tablespoon of o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add the peeled and deveined shrimp and cook for 2 to 3 minutes per side until they turn pink and are cooked through. Remove the shrimp from the skillet and set aside.
  3. Sauté Aromatics: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of oil to the skillet and sauté the minced garlic and ginger for about 30 seconds until fragrant, stirring continuously to prevent burning.
  4. Cook the Vegetables: Add the sliced red bell pepper, yellow bell pepper, broccoli florets, and thinly sliced carrot to the skillet. Stir-fry the vegetables for 4 to 5 minutes until they become tender-crisp, keeping the vegetables vibrant and slightly crunchy.
  5. Combine Shrimp and Sauce: Return the cooked shrimp to the skillet with the vegetables. Pour the prepared sauce over the shrimp and vegetables, tossing everything together for 1 to 2 minutes until evenly coated and heated through.
  6. Garnish and Serve: Remove the skillet from heat. Garnish the stir-fry with sliced green onions and sprinkle with sesame seeds if desired. Serve hot over steamed rice, cauliflower rice, or noodles for a complete meal.

Notes

  • Serve the stir-fry over steamed rice, cauliflower rice, or your favorite noodles for a satisfying meal.
  • You can customize the vegetable mix by adding snow peas, zucchini, mushrooms, or other preferred veggies.
  • Adjust the spice level by varying the amount of sriracha and crushed red pepper flakes to suit your taste.
  • For a gluten-free option, use gluten-free soy sauce.
  • Ensure shrimp are cooked thoroughly but not overcooked to maintain their juicy texture.
